Jump to content
xt:Commerce Community Forum

Template-Anpassung je nach Bildschirmauflösung


Cyreen

Recommended Posts

Hallo,

könnt ihr mir sagen, wie ich die "Gesamtbreite" des Webshops so anpassen kann, dass diese sich je nach Auflösung anpasst ?

Ich benutze aktuell einen 27" Monitor und dort kommt der Webshop ziemlich klein rüber. Auf einem 15" sieht das deutlich besser aus, aber die Tendenz geht ja bekanntlich immer mehr auf grössere Monitor über.

Aktuell hat die Website schätzungsweise eine Breite von 900-1000 Pixel. Ich möchte dies gern automatisch (je nach Bildschirmauflösung) bis auf ca. 100-150 Pixel von jedem Rand entfernt anpassen.

Bitte gebt mir eine Info wie und wo genau ich was ändern muss.

Ich danke euch vielmals für die Hilfe

Gruss

Alex

Link to comment
Share on other sites

Bisschen wenig Info um dir helfen zu können. Willst du die rechte Spalte beibehalten? Ich beispielsweise habe die einfach raus geworfen und nutze den Teil rechts variabel, indem ich wenn ich mich recht erinnere in erster Linie eine Klasse mit "wrap" im Namen aus der CSS Datei raus gelöscht habe.

Link to comment
Share on other sites

Hallo,

ich möchte die linke und rechte Leiste von der Grösse (Breite) her behalten. nur der Mittelteil soll auf die Screenbreite (je nach Auflösung) gestreckt werden. Zwischen Displayrand und rechte bzw. linke Leiste soll ein Platz von ca. 50-100 Pixel sein, damit die Leisten nicht direkt am Rand sind.

Ich kann auch gern mal das Template posten. Vielleicht bringt das euch mehr :-)

Wäre jedenfalls dankbar, wenn man mir dann die Zeile posten könnte, welche ich abändern muss.

kleine Info:

ich benutze das Standard-Template. Dieses habe ich nur umbenannt und einen neuen Ordner im Template erstellt. die Dateien wurden nahezu nicht verändert. Einzig und allein habe ich die Farben meiner Website angepasst bzw. die Grafikdateien durch neue ersetzt. Dateinamen sind immer noch die gleichen.

Gruss

Alex

Link to comment
Share on other sites

so wie auf meiner seite mit der hardware ist es quatsch da hast du recht

aber mir ging es nur um die beantwortung der frage .

Also das ist alles moglich was er möchte

besser um gesetst währe

rechts mit 180px zb das menu

links mit 200px wahrenkorb, suche, werbung,

den inhalt mit den Produckten in divs mit 300x330px

damit zb bei kleinen viewport 2artikel neben einander sind und bei grosser auflösung eben 5

das ist alles problemlos möglich

hier zb statischer mit ul li als content optimal für google http://www.sexshop-dildo-punk.de/

Link to comment
Share on other sites

Hallo,

ich habe mir mal die Mühe gemacht einen Screenshot zu erstellen und die gewünschten Abstände farblich markiert. Darüber hinaus habe ich die CSS-Datei dazu noch hochgeladen.

Ich wäre für einen Tipp, Hilfe usw. sehr dankbar. Vielleicht ist es für jemanden von Euch ohne grosse Arbeit mein Template so abzuändern, dass die gewünschten Angaben berücksichtigt werden.

Vielleicht kann man dann im Stylesheet die genaue Position für mich markieren damit ich die gewünschten Abstände selber später noch etwas anpassen kann.

Vielen Dank für die Hilfe und ein grosses Sorry, dass ich so eine Anfrage hier poste. Bisher hab ich alles selbst konfigurieren können, jedoch übersteige ich bei CSS mein Niveau.

Gruss

Alex

post-91354-14337914988831_thumb.jpg

stylesheet.css.zip

Link to comment
Share on other sites

  • 4 weeks later...

hat jemand noch eine Lösung, wie ich das anpassen kann. Bisher kamen nur Begriffe und Zahlen usw. jedoch kann ich das nicht in mein Template einfügen, da ich nicht weiss wie die Zeile vollständig auszusehen hat.

Ich bitte daher um Hilfe.

Besten Dank

Alex

Link to comment
Share on other sites

so wie auf meiner seite mit der hardware ist es quatsch da hast du recht

aber mir ging es nur um die beantwortung der frage .

Also das ist alles moglich was er möchte

besser um gesetst währe

rechts mit 180px zb das menu

links mit 200px wahrenkorb, suche, werbung,

den inhalt mit den Produckten in divs mit 300x330px

damit zb bei kleinen viewport 2artikel neben einander sind und bei grosser auflösung eben 5

das ist alles problemlos möglich

hier zb statischer mit ul li als content optimal für google DILDOPUNK .DE einfach anders. Dildos und Vibratoren in bester Marken Qualität

Wenn dir das noch nicht langt als tip dann solltest du dir ertmal ein buch kaufen ich würde dir das empfehlen Galileo Computing : Buch : XHTML, HTML und CSS

also ganz erlich das was du möchtest in der art Amazon design bloss als div layout ohne tabellen ist problemloss möglich aber das ist schon ein bischen arbeit wenn ich das umsätzen würde , dann würde ich es nicht verschenken da man doch etwas arbeit hat.

Link to comment
Share on other sites

ich möchte kein Amazon-Design... wenn dem so wäre, dann würde ich mir direkt ein solches Template kaufen. Ich möchte nur 3 Boxen (grössenmässig) ändern. Das sollte nicht extrem aufwendig sein. Wahrscheinlich sind das ca. 50-150 Zeichen Quellcode mehr. Evtl. fehlt an manchen stellen auch nur eine andere Zahl inkl. %-Zeichen. Wenn jemand 200-300 EUR dafür verlangt, da komm ich ja mit einem neuen Template billiger :D

Gruss

Alex

Link to comment
Share on other sites

#wrap {widht:100%}

so ist es möglich aber nicht optimal (es würde zwar verursachen das es den inhalt auf die monitor breite verteilt aber der inhalt würde zerflisse) und bzw. 100% unterstützt nicht jeder ältere browser.

option zwei margin:0 und keine weiten angabe das ist besser aber immer noch nicht gut.

--------------------------------------------------------------------------

ich würde dir immer noch zum Buchkauf raten da das was in dem Buch steht

ungefähr ein drittel des grundwissen ausmacht um selber am Template zu fummeln.

Oder sonst ein Template kaufen wo nicht mal die wirklich obtimal umgesetzt sind. es geht ja nicht nur ums aussehen auch der SEO wegen kann man noch hochdrehen.

Link to comment
Share on other sites

  • 2 weeks later...

Also an besagtem Problem der Breite hänge ich nun schon seit Tagen fest. Gebe ich dem inneren Content 100% verschiebt es die rechte Boxenleiste kurzerhand unter den Inhalt. Egal was ich anwende, das Standardlayout lässt sich einfach nicht dahin bewegen, das der Mittelteil variabel ist. Lässt man die Breite ganz weg, klappt es auch nicht, sondern der Inhalt wird noch kleiner. HELP. PLEASE!!

Link to comment
Share on other sites

du hast geschrieben den inneren content hast du 100 gegeben dann ist es auch lögich das die box verutscht..

du solst aber in der styleshet.css

ca bei zeile 46

#wrap {

background-color:#FFFFFF;

border-color:#FFFFFF;

border-style:solid;

border-width:0 1px;

margin:auto;

width:100%;}

und nicht bei

#content ;)

das sollte sich nicht böse anhören aber wirklich das ist einfachstes grundwissen deshalb empfehle ich dir das buch was für einsteiger geignet ist

Link to comment
Share on other sites

Ich versuch es mal für die Profis zu verdeutlichen

wrap 100%

contentwrap 100%

content 100%

Das funktioniert NICHT. Die rechte Box befindet sich ja im contentwrap, wird daher permanent von dem content verdrängt und rutscht darunter. Dinge wie 80% für Content bringen auch nicht den gewünschten Erfolg, da teilweise die Box dennoch darunter rutscht.

Lässt man Größenangabe ganz weg, wird der content nur auf die minimal mögliche Breite reduziert.

Ich habe die Seite bereits auf 100% getrimmt, die Boxen sind immer da wo sie hingehören, aber der content in der Mitte lässt sich nicht einstellen. Entweder zu breit (100%) oder zu schmal (ohne Angabe).

Link to comment
Share on other sites

Was der giller sagt, ist schon längst umgesetzt. Genau da liegt ja das Problem.

Das hier hab ich zudem aus der ORIGINAL stylesheet. Das wrap (hier nicht dabei) ist bereits auf 100%.

/* CONTENT WRAPPER */

#contentwrap {clear:both;width:950px;padding:0; min-height:500px;}


/* LEFT COLUMN */

#leftcol {float:left; width:200px; padding:0px 0px 15px 0px;}


/* RIGHT COLUMN */

#rightcol {float:right; width:200px; padding:0px 0px 15px 0px;}


/* MAIN CONTENT */

#content {float:left; width:495px; padding:0px 25px 0px 25px; margin-bottom:15px;}

#contentfull {width:890px; padding:0px 30px 0px 30px; margin-bottom:15px;}

Der Maincontent ist doch festgenagelt auf 495px. Wenn ich nun diesen breiter haben will, schmeisst er die rechte Box runter. Ich bekomme alles auf Seitenbreite, aber nicht den verdammten Content in der Mitte. Und ich finde keinen Fehler.

Link to comment
Share on other sites

Ganz ehrlich? Ich gebs gleich auf....

Deine Änderung bewirkt das es im maximierten Modus passt und alles breit ist. Aber der Mittelteil (content) wird nicht kleiner, wenn man das Fenster kleiner macht sondern verharrt still steif und dumm auf der festgelegten Breite!!! Stattdessen müsste er sich doch zusammenstauchen lassen!?

Dabei will ich es nur so haben wie bei king-of-hardware.... Mich treibt das Template echt zum verzweifeln.

Link to comment
Share on other sites

Archived

This topic is now archived and is closed to further replies.

×
  • Create New...